Biography

1776 Project
Sergeant Jonathan Harnden served with 11th Regiment, Connecticut Militia during the American Revolution.
Daughters of the American Revolution
Jonathan Harnden is a DAR Patriot Ancestor, A050927.

Born 15 May 1733 in Wilmington, Massachusetts, son of Barchias Harnden and Sarah.[1][2]

1755: Served in the French & Indian War?

Served in the Revolutionary War: Patriot A050927 [3]

Probably married by 1755, although no marriage is found in the Wilmington MA VR. Nor are any births of his children.

Was in Granville, New York, by 1810.[4]

Hotel and Dance Hall Owner in Granville, Washington, New York

There was a Jonathan Harnden who married Rhoda Abbott in Wilmington, Massachusetts in 1809, but this seems awfully late for him.[5] (more likely this is the Jonathan Harnden, born in 1784, son of Benjamin Harndon).

Buried in Lee-Oatman Cemetery, South Granville, Washington County, New York, USA[6]
